there is a local quarry near my house that is super clear. the visibility is about 25 feet. i can see bass in shallow water sitting in the weeds and they dont spook when i walk by. I cast all types of lures and none are producing. what lures will get these fish to bite?

Posted

try some soft plastics in natrual colors, with a slow fall rate.  Make sure you cast close to the fish, but not right on top. downsize if needed

A "natural" bubblegum colored finesse worm rigged wacky on fluorocarbon line. Be patient for the bait to fall the 20' or so. Add a size 3d steel finishing nail in the worm head if it is windy.

Using that color, you can track the decent and see when they take it. Works for me !!!!!!!

The problem is: you see them---> they see you and that immediately puts them in alert mode so it has more to do with cocealing your presence and making an excellent presentation that with what you fish, natural colors ? ---> BS ( don 't know why people always come to that ), why I say it ? because 30 years bass fishing experience tells me so, my home town is blessed with several small lakes plus numerous well fed irrigation ponds with crystal clear water where I 've caught hundreds of fish with completely un"natural" colors ( like bubble gum/charetruese/orange/firetiger baits ). However concealing my presence does have a direct impact on how the fish respond to my offerings.

What Raul said. I just experienced this the other day at my favorite 25-30 foot visibility lake. Walked down close to the water to see the structure/cover and undoubtedly the local bass saw me and I saw them, cast to them for no bites. Came back 20 minutes later and I was casting to the edge of the cover I had seen while standing 15 feet from the water, two bites and two fish.
